Kale is a type of cabbage that has edible green or purple leaves. This hardy vegetable thrives in the winter months and can tolerate cold as low as 5°F (-15°C) without protection. Kale is tastier after growing through a heavy frost.

Web5 feb. 2024 · Sow kale seeds in your outdoor garden one inch apart and ¼”- ½’’ deep in rows. Make rows 18” apart. If you are planting kale in a square foot garden – you can plant 1 kale in 1’ x 1’ square. Water your kale after planting – the soil should be wet, but not soggy. After 3 weeks, thin seedlings 8 to12 inches apart. Web18 aug. 2024 · Daylight hours are limited in the colder months and kale loves its sunlight. Mustard grows best when temperatures do not exceed 75°F and temperatures down to 32°F do not seriously damage young plants. greenworks corporate headquartersWebKale grows best when temperatures do not exceed 75°F. Young plants are not seriously damaged by temperatures down to 25°F. Mature plants are extremely hardy and can withstand very cold temperatures. Transplants should be planted 4-5 weeks before the last frost free date for the growing area.
